Cognitive and physical performance are well preserved following standard blood donation: A noninferiority, randomized clinical trial.

Executive, cognitive, and physical functions were well preserved after blood donation. This study supports the hypothesis that a WBB does not decrease donor combat performance. The categorical prohibition of physical exercise following blood donation might need to be reconsidered in both military and civilian populations.
